Physical Cartridge Inspection: Key Indicators of Authenticity

The first line of defense against counterfeit Pokemon Pearl EU cartridges is a thorough physical inspection. Examining the cartridge itself can reveal several telltale signs of a fake. Pay close attention to the following aspects:

  • Label Quality: The label on a genuine Pokemon Pearl EU cartridge should be clear, crisp, and professionally printed. Look for any signs of blurriness, pixelation, or misaligned text. The colors should be vibrant and accurate, matching the official artwork. A common mistake on fake labels is the use of incorrect fonts or inconsistent text sizes. Carefully compare the label to images of authentic cartridges online to identify any discrepancies. The label should also be securely affixed to the cartridge, with no peeling or bubbling. If the label appears to be a low-quality sticker or is easily removable, it's a red flag.
  • Cartridge Color and Plastic Quality: The genuine Pokemon Pearl EU cartridge should be a specific shade of dark grey, almost black. The plastic should feel solid and high-quality, not cheap or flimsy. Counterfeit cartridges often use lower-grade plastic that feels lighter and more brittle. The color may also be slightly off, appearing too light or too dark. Examine the cartridge under good lighting to accurately assess the color and plastic quality.
  • Nintendo Logo and Imprints: Authentic Nintendo DS cartridges feature the Nintendo logo embossed on the top of the cartridge, as well as imprinted text on the back. The Nintendo logo should be crisp and well-defined, with no smudging or irregularities. The imprinted text on the back should be clear and legible, and should include the Nintendo copyright information and the game code. Fake cartridges may have a poorly defined logo, misaligned text, or even missing imprints altogether. Use a magnifying glass to carefully inspect the logo and imprints for any imperfections.
  • Game Code: The game code is a crucial identifier of authenticity. On a genuine Pokemon Pearl EU cartridge, the game code (e.g., CPUE) is printed on the label and also etched into the plastic on the back of the cartridge. The two codes should match exactly. If the codes don't match, or if the etched code is missing altogether, it's a clear indication of a fake. The game code can also be used to verify the region of the game. The EU version of Pokemon Pearl should have a game code that corresponds to the European region.
  • Cartridge Connector Pins: The connector pins on the bottom of the cartridge, which connect to the Nintendo DS console, should be clean and gold-colored. They should be evenly spaced and free from any damage or corrosion. Fake cartridges may have connector pins that are dull, silver-colored, or unevenly spaced. The pins may also be poorly manufactured, leading to connectivity issues or even damage to the console.

By carefully examining these physical characteristics, you can significantly increase your chances of spotting a fake Pokemon Pearl EU cartridge. However, physical inspection alone is not always foolproof. Some counterfeiters have become very adept at replicating the physical appearance of genuine cartridges. Therefore, it's essential to supplement the physical inspection with other methods, such as in-game checks.

In-Game Verification: Unmasking the Fakes

While physical inspection provides valuable clues, in-game verification is often the most definitive way to determine the authenticity of a Pokemon Pearl EU cartridge. Booting up the game and playing it for a short period can reveal telltale signs of a fake that are not apparent from a physical examination alone. Here are some key in-game aspects to check:

  • Startup Screen and Nintendo Logo: When you first insert the cartridge and turn on your Nintendo DS, pay close attention to the startup sequence. A genuine Pokemon Pearl EU game should display the official Nintendo logo and the Pokemon logo clearly and smoothly. The logos should appear crisp and vibrant, with no distortions or glitches. Fake cartridges often have a distorted or pixelated Nintendo logo, or the logo may be missing altogether. The startup sequence may also be noticeably slower or more erratic on a fake cartridge.
  • Game Loading Time: Genuine Nintendo DS games load relatively quickly. If your Pokemon Pearl EU cartridge takes an unusually long time to load the game, it's a potential sign of a fake. Counterfeit cartridges often use cheaper memory chips, which result in slower loading times. A legitimate game should load the title screen within a few seconds. If it takes significantly longer, be suspicious.
  • Save Functionality: One of the most common issues with fake Pokemon games is save data corruption. Try playing the game for a short period, saving your progress, and then reloading the save file. If the game fails to save or load properly, or if your save data is corrupted, it's a strong indication that the cartridge is a fake. Counterfeit cartridges often use unreliable memory chips that are prone to data loss. Saving and loading multiple times can help to reveal save functionality issues.
  • Game Performance and Glitches: Play the game for a while and observe its performance. Genuine Pokemon Pearl EU games should run smoothly, with no significant lag or slowdown. Look for any graphical glitches, audio distortions, or other unusual behavior. Fake cartridges may suffer from performance issues due to the use of inferior hardware. Glitches and bugs that are not present in the genuine game are also common indicators of a fake.
  • Language and Text: Ensure that the in-game language and text are correct for the EU version of Pokemon Pearl. The EU version should be available in multiple European languages, such as English, French, German, Spanish, and Italian. Check for any spelling errors, grammatical mistakes, or awkward phrasing. Counterfeit games often have poor translations or incorrect text due to the use of unofficial ROMs.
  • In-Game Music and Sound Effects: Listen carefully to the in-game music and sound effects. The audio quality should be clear and crisp, with no distortion or static. Fake cartridges may have muffled or distorted audio due to the use of low-quality sound chips. The music and sound effects should also match the original game. If you notice any discrepancies, such as missing sound effects or incorrect music tracks, it's a red flag.

By carefully observing these in-game aspects, you can often identify a fake Pokemon Pearl EU cartridge even if the physical appearance is convincing. However, some counterfeiters are becoming increasingly sophisticated, making it more challenging to spot fakes. Therefore, it's always best to combine physical inspection and in-game verification with other precautions, such as buying from reputable sources.

Buying Smart: Reputable Sources and Price Considerations

In addition to physical and in-game checks, where you buy your Pokemon Pearl EU cartridge plays a crucial role in ensuring its authenticity. Choosing reputable sources and being mindful of pricing can significantly reduce your risk of purchasing a fake.

  • Reputable Retailers: Purchasing from well-known and established retailers is the safest option. Large electronics stores, game retailers, and online marketplaces with strong reputations for selling genuine products are generally reliable. These retailers have a vested interest in maintaining their reputation and are less likely to knowingly sell counterfeit goods. Look for retailers that offer guarantees and return policies, providing you with recourse if you accidentally purchase a fake.
  • Online Marketplaces: Buyer Beware: Online marketplaces like eBay and Amazon can be convenient options for finding Pokemon Pearl EU, but they also pose a higher risk of encountering counterfeit cartridges. While these platforms have measures in place to combat counterfeit sales, they are not always foolproof. When buying from online marketplaces, carefully vet the seller. Look for sellers with high ratings and positive feedback from previous buyers. Read the product descriptions and reviews carefully, paying attention to any comments about authenticity or quality. If the seller is offering multiple copies of the game at suspiciously low prices, it's a red flag.
  • Used Game Stores: Used game stores can be a good source for finding older games like Pokemon Pearl EU. However, it's important to choose reputable stores that have experience in identifying counterfeit games. Ask the store about their authentication process and return policy. Inspect the cartridge carefully before purchasing, using the physical and in-game checks outlined earlier.
  • Private Sellers: Buying from private sellers can be risky, as there is less accountability than with established retailers. If you choose to buy from a private seller, meet in person if possible and thoroughly inspect the cartridge before handing over any money. Ask the seller questions about the game's history and provenance. If the seller is hesitant to answer questions or allow you to inspect the cartridge, it's a red flag.
  • Price Considerations: Price can be a significant indicator of authenticity. If the price of a Pokemon Pearl EU cartridge seems too good to be true, it probably is. Counterfeiters often sell fake games at significantly lower prices to lure in unsuspecting buyers. Research the market value of a genuine copy of Pokemon Pearl EU in your region. If a seller is offering the game for a fraction of the average price, be very cautious. A legitimate copy of Pokemon Pearl EU, especially one in good condition, will typically command a premium price due to its rarity and desirability.

By choosing reputable sources and being mindful of pricing, you can significantly reduce your risk of purchasing a fake Pokemon Pearl EU cartridge. Remember, it's always better to pay a bit more for a genuine copy than to waste your money on a counterfeit.
